πŸ” What Is Rabby Wallet?

Rabby Wallet is a browser-based crypto wallet that supports Ethereum and Ethereum-compatible blockchains (EVM chains). It allows users to store assets, connect to dApps, sign transactions, and manage DeFi positions β€” all while maintaining full control over private keys.

Unlike custodial wallets, Rabby does not store user funds or recovery phrases. Everything is encrypted and stored locally on your device.

🌐 Supported Networks

Rabby Wallet automatically detects and supports many popular networks, including:

Ethereum (ETH)

Binance Smart Chain (BSC)

Polygon

Arbitrum

Optimism

Avalanche

Fantom

Base

Linea

One of Rabby’s biggest advantages is automatic network switching, reducing failed transactions and gas errors.

πŸ› οΈ How to Set Up Rabby Wallet Option 1: Create a New Wallet

Open the Rabby Wallet extension

Click Create New Wallet

Set a strong wallet password

Write down your seed (recovery) phrase in the correct order

Confirm the recovery phrase to complete setup

This recovery phrase is the only way to restore your wallet if your device is lost or damaged.

Option 2: Import an Existing Wallet

Rabby Wallet allows you to import wallets from other providers.

You can import using:

Seed phrase

Private key

Hardware wallet (Ledger support)

After importing, your assets will appear automatically once networks are detected.

πŸ” Rabby Wallet Login (Unlock Process)

Rabby Wallet does not use email or username logins.

To access your wallet:

Click the Rabby Wallet extension icon

Enter your wallet password

Unlock the wallet

If you forget your password, you must restore the wallet using your seed phrase β€” passwords cannot be recovered.

πŸ›‘οΈ Security Features of Rabby Wallet

Rabby Wallet is known for its advanced security design:

πŸ” Transaction Simulation

Before signing, Rabby simulates transactions to show:

Token changes

Potential risks

Approval limits

⚠️ Risk Alerts

The wallet warns users about:

Suspicious contracts

Unlimited token approvals

Known scam addresses

πŸ” Local Key Storage

Private keys are encrypted and stored locally on your device, not on external servers.
